内容正文:
生活与算法
1
一、生活中的算法
1、先将甲瓶中的液体倒入丙瓶。
2、再将乙瓶中的液体倒入甲瓶。
3、最后将丙瓶中的液体倒入乙瓶。
2
算法的概念
算法就是解决问题的方法和步骤。
思考:若有三瓶不同的液体,如何两两交换?
3
二、计算机解决问题的一般过程
1、问题分析、建立数学模型
2、确定算法
3、编写程序
4、调试程序
4
变量的概念
变量是指数据的存储单元,其中存储的数据在程序执行过程中是可变的。
5
变量的概念
任务:用自然语言描述三个瓶子相互交换液体的算法?
6
三、计算机语言的发展
机器语言
汇编语言
高级语言
低级 高级
BASIC语言、C语言、Java、VB等。
7
二进制
二进制是计算机技术中一种常用的数制。用0和1两个数码来表示。
8
小结
1、什么是算法?什么是变量?
2、请描述计算机解决问题的一般过程。
3、请描述计算机语言的发展过程。
9
拓展
用没有刻度的3毫升量杯和5毫升量杯,如何量出1毫升的水?请写出算法。
10
拓展
请将算法写入TXT文本,并将文本更名为:姓名+学号.txt,最后上交至电子教室。
如:张三01.txt
11
再 见
12
$$